Can you explain why your opted for floral foam instead of the extruded styrofoam (which you're more famous for :))?
I bought a few blocks of floral foam at Michael's a couple years ago but other people keep telling me it's too messy, and doesn't hold to paint very well (hope you can prove them wrong!)
elsongs 2 years ago
I read about using florist foam in N Scale magazine and thought I'd give it a try. In addition for th smaller scenes I'm using it for I didn't want to have to buy another 4 X 8 sheet of pink extruded foam. I'm not to sure what these other people mean by "I doesn't hold Paint well". It seems to hold paint fine. If they mean that florist foam is a more fragile than extruded foam then that is correct plus it is a bit messier (in it's own way)
